Lean Capacity Assessment Roles (UK) Description
Lean Consultant (Nonprofit) Improves nonprofit operational efficiency using Lean principles. High demand for process improvement expertise.
Lean Project Manager (Charity Sector) Manages Lean improvement projects within charitable organizations. Strong project management and Lean skills needed.
Process Improvement Analyst (NGO) Analyzes and optimizes workflows within NGOs. Data analysis and Lean methodologies are crucial.
Operations Manager (Lean Focus) Oversees daily operations, implementing Lean strategies for maximum impact. Requires experience with Lean tools and techniques.
